问题内容: 我制作了一个Java应用程序,并将所有类捆绑在jar文件中。当我从eclipse运行项目时,我的应用程序正在成功运行。但是,当我尝试运行文件时,没有得到应用程序使用的图标。在代码中,我从项目文件夹中存在的images目录中获取图标。使用jar时如何将这些图像文件呈现给最终用户? 我正在加载图像,如下所示: 我也尝试过 和 但这会导致错误: 问题答案: 您需要从类路径而不是从本地磁盘文件
问题内容: 我在Java中有一个ArrayList,我需要在其中查找所有出现的特定对象。方法ArrayList.indexOf(Object)仅发现一个事件,因此似乎我需要其他东西。 问题答案: 我认为您不必对此太幻想。以下应该可以正常工作:
问题内容: 目前,我正在研究Java代理以汇编内存统计信息。借助工具API,我可以持有这些类(并对其进行操作)。使用纯Java,我可以估算每个对象使用的资源。到目前为止,一切都很好。 我现在面临的问题是“如何掌握特定类的每个Object实例”。我可以进行字节码操作以获得对象实例的所有权,但是我希望还有另外一个我不知道的API,它可以帮助我完成我的目标而无需进行如此繁琐的干预。最后,应将对性能的影响
问题内容: 我发现了Java:查找方法的所有调用者–获取所有调用特定方法的方法,这提示如何查找特定方法的所有调用者。 那么,如何获得静态字段的用户呢? 例如,当我有静态的,并且它与访问,如何获得 ? 问题答案: 该示例基于org.eclipse.jdt.internal。*类,由于JDT SearchEngine API具有全功能,因此我认为您无需花费太多精力。就您而言,下面的代码就足够了:
问题内容: 我想在不知道文件名的情况下将所有图像加载到文件夹中,然后将它们存储到Integer向量中-在运行时。 实际上,我需要执行与本示例相同的操作:http : //developer.android.com/resources/tutorials/views/hello- gridview.html 但是在运行时却不知道文件名。 有什么帮助吗? 在您回答之后,我知道该怎么做…但是我不知道如何
问题内容: 考虑一下此片段- 这导致了NPE。似乎正在这样做,并且既然是,就会抛出NPE。为什么要评估这种情况?第二个表达式是,因此计算为。因此,无论后续操作的真值如何,都将为false。在这种情况下,为什么要进行评估? 本文和本文声称,如果不需要确定结果,则可能不评估所有表达式。显然,这里似乎并非如此。 在Java 7之前- 这不会抛出NPE,因为是它会返回那里本身。因此,我们可以说这与上述Ja
问题内容: 我需要以各种精度级别解析Java中ISO8601格式的字符串。我需要解析的字符串的一些示例是: 2018年 2018-10 2018-10-15 2018-10-15T12:00 2018-10-15T12:00:30 2018-10-15T12:00:30.123 20181015 201810151200 20181015120030 20181015120030.123 2018
问题内容: 我试图找到Java运行时可用的所有类的名称,并在Guava中使用反射将代码成功实现了一些成功,例如: 这似乎在某种程度上可以使我获得大约2500个类名,但是并没有找到所有的类名,特别是我确实需要了解的所有类,特别是java.lang,java.util等。 我应该为此使用其他类加载器吗?我也尝试过 任何指针将不胜感激。谢谢 恩文 我从这篇文章中使用了更多信息:如何列出特定类加载器中加载
问题内容: 我有一个字符数组,一次最多可以容纳50000个字符。该数组的内容通过套接字连接来。但是,不能保证此字符缓冲区不会有任何空元素。然后,我需要将此字符数组转换为字符串(例如,新的String(buffer);)。我的问题是,每当我从套接字收到的缓冲区长度不超过50000时,如何从此char数组或String中删除剩余的元素或空元素?如果没有,您建议的最有效方法是什么? / 这是当前的实现
问题内容: 根据API文档,设备所有者应用可以通过以下调用来修改一些“安全设置”,尤其是LOCATION_MODE: 个人资料或设备所有者致电以更新Settings.Secure设置[…] 设备所有者可以另外更新以下设置:LOCATION_MODE 根据我的理解,LOCATION_MODE的值为int(分别为0(禁用位置),1(仅用于GPS),2(用于省电模式)和3(用于高精度)。 我的问题是参数
问题内容: 使用KTable时,当实例/使用者数等于分区数时,Kafka流不允许实例从特定主题的多个分区中读取。我尝试使用GlobalKTable实现此目的,但问题是数据将被覆盖,也无法对其应用聚合。 假设我有一个名为“ data_in”的主题,具有3个分区(P1,P2,P3)。当我运行Kafka流应用程序的3个实例(I1,I2,I3)时,我希望每个实例都从“ data_in”的所有分区中读取数据
问题内容: svnkit.com是Java中的SVN库。例如,您可以按照以下方式获取SVN存储库的日志: 如何列出SVN信息库的所有文件(不检出文件)? 问题答案: 检查。有关如何使用的示例,请参见等。就像SVNKit仓库 1.7.x分支的最新版本中的一样。
问题内容: 我正在开发人力资源软件。我需要检查员工的出勤情况。我们有ZKSoftware F702-s指纹设备。我需要在Java项目中从中获取信息。我搜索了sdk,并找到了如何使用此sdk的文档,但未找到任何内容。帮助我我的项目。我能做什么? 问题答案: 我找到了指纹设备的动态库,该动态库是activex组件,并且我解决了JACOB的问题是JAVA- COM桥,该桥允许您从Java调用COM自动化
问题内容: 我已经开发了一个Android应用程序。 在这里,我必须在所有android活动上设置标签栏底部。我该怎么办。请给我这些解决方案。 我总共有10个活动,这意味着所有10个活动的标签栏都显示在botton上。我该如何在android.please帮助我。 这是我的第一项活动: tabbar.xml: 在第一个选项卡中必须执行MainActivity(GridView)活动。它被很好地唤醒
问题内容: 我在解析json响应时遇到一个小问题,因为每当我发送请求时,它都会不断更新,我看到的所有示例都使我们提供了标签名。我的问题是我试图解析通过API发送的请求中的数据,并且我想在开始解析之前列出JSON对象内存在的所有JSON数组的所有标签。是否有可能在Android中。http://api.yamgo.tv/channel?apiKey=187abeefc53f900600dc0fc5b